In that environment, a massive science-fiction universe like Warhammer could represent a bold new direction. The setting blends gothic science fiction, ancient mythology, cosmic horror, and relentless warfare across a galaxy locked in eternal conflict.
For viewers unfamiliar with the franchise, the Warhammer 40,000 universe is set tens of thousands of years in the future. Humanity exists within a sprawling empire constantly threatened by alien species, demonic forces, and internal corruption.
The tone is famously grim. In the words often used by fans, “there is only war.” That atmosphere gives the setting a dramatic intensity rarely explored in mainstream blockbuster storytelling.
Industry analysts believe that darker tone may actually help differentiate the franchise from other cinematic universes. While superhero stories often focus on heroic triumph, Warhammer narratives frequently explore sacrifice, fanaticism, and the cost of survival.
